
|
 |

Home
> Lexikon > NNTP
NNTP
In Kürze
NNTP ist die Abkürzung für "Network News Transfer Protocol"
(Netzwerk-Nachrichten-Übertragungs-Protokoll). Mit Hilfe dieses Protokolls werden die Beiträge in den Diskussionsforen des
Internet-Dienstes Usenet übertragen und verwaltet.
|
|
Synonyme und Abkürzungen
Network News Transport Protocol
Ähnliche Begriffe
Usenet,
Newsgroup,
Protokoll
Überblick
Das Protokoll NNTP wird verwendet, um Beiträge innerhalb des Internet-Dienstes
Usenet
zu übertragen. Es regelt sowohl die Kommunikation der Newsserver, auf denen die
Beiträge lagern, untereinander, als auch die Kommunikation zwischen Newsserver
und dem Rechner des Benutzers.
Das Protokoll ist dabei nur für die technischen Vorgänge im Hintergrund
zuständig; praktische Fragen im Zusammenhang mit der Benutzung von Newsgroups werden dort und im Eintrag Usenet behandelt.
Detail
NNTP ist ein Protokoll für die Verteilung, das Suchen, Finden und Verschicken
von Newsgroup-Beiträgen. Das Protokoll ist so ausgelegt, dass die Beiträge der
Teilnehmer auf zentralen Rechnern gespeichert werden, und Benutzer nur
diejenigen Beiträge zum Herunterladen auswählen, die sie interessieren. NNTP
regelt dabei verschiedene Vorgänge, insbesondere:
- Die Übertragung von News-Beiträgen zum Endnutzer
- Das Hochladen neuer Beiträge und deren Verteilung im Schneeballsystem an
andere Newsserver
- Die Verwaltung aller gespeicherten Beiträge
- Den Austausch von Beiträgen zwischen den einzelnen Newsservern
- Das Aussortieren von Beiträgen, die ein bestimmtes Alter überschritten
haben
Es gibt keinen einzelnen zentralen Rechner, auf dem alle Beiträge gespeichert
werden, sondern nur grössere und kleinere Newsserver. Ein grösserer Rechner
verteilt News-Beiträge an eine Reihe kleinerer Rechner, die sie wiederum an
noch kleinere Netzwerke oder an den Endbenutzer weitergeben.
Wenn Beiträge verschickt oder neue Beiträge heruntergeladen werden sollen,
verbindet sich der zuständige News-Server über das NNTP-Protokoll mit einem anderen
Newsserver. Dabei überprüft er als erstes, ob auf dem Server-Rechner, mit dem er die Daten austauscht, neue
Newsgroups ins Leben gerufen wurden und legt diese Newsgroups bei sich selbst
an. Als nächstes stellt der Client-Rechner fest, ob neue Beiträge in den Newsgroups,
die aktualisiert werden sollen, vorliegen. Er empfängt eine Liste der neuen
Beiträge vom Server und kann dann die Übertragung der Artikel veranlassen, die
in seiner eigenen Sammlung noch nicht vorhanden sind. Danach teilt der Client
dem Server mit, welche neuen Beiträge seit dem letzten Abgleich bei ihm
eingegangen sind, und der Server übernimmt diejenigen, die noch nicht auf
anderen Wegen dort eingetroffen sind. Neue Artikel werden so übertragen,
Duplikate dagegen ignoriert. Bevor NNTP 1986 eingeführt wurde, kam zur
Übertragung von News das simplere Protokoll UUCP zum Einsatz, das ohne
interaktiven Abgleich einfach Daten auf andere Rechner kopiert.
NNTP dient nur der Kommunikation zwischen Rechnern; auf Benutzerfreundlichkeit
wird dabei kein Wert gelegt. Alle zusätzlichen Funktionen, die Lesern und
Verfassern von News-Beiträgen das Leben erleichtern, stellt spezielle Software
- der Newsreader oder Newsclient -
auf dem Rechner des Benutzers zur Verfügung.
Weiterführende Links
RFC 977 beschreibt das Protokoll detailliert (englisch):
http://www.w3.org/Protocols/rfc977/rfc977.html
|
|
 |